Solution for 5(3-2x)+1=86 equation:


Simplifying
5(3 + -2x) + 1 = 86
(3 * 5 + -2x * 5) + 1 = 86
(15 + -10x) + 1 = 86

Reorder the terms:
15 + 1 + -10x = 86

Combine like terms: 15 + 1 = 16
16 + -10x = 86

Solving
16 + -10x = 86

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-16' to each side of the equation.
16 + -16 + -10x = 86 + -16

Combine like terms: 16 + -16 = 0
0 + -10x = 86 + -16
-10x = 86 + -16

Combine like terms: 86 + -16 = 70
-10x = 70

Divide each side by '-10'.
x = -7

Simplifying
x = -7
